GLD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

1,086 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SPDR Gold Trust (GLD)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$12.6B — up 8.3% from $11.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 190 funds opened new GLD positions and 99 closed out — a net gain of 91 holders — while 289 added to existing stakes and 370 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$550M. The largest seller was Graham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.16B sold.
